Dos:
Research and Referrals:
Before you hire basement remodel contractors, do your research. Start by asking friends, family, and neighbors for recommendations. Word of mouth can be a trusted and valuable resource when looking for contractors in Orland Park, IL. Additionally, ensure to check the online reviews and ratings to get a sense of the contractor’s reputation.
Verify Credentials:
Ensure that the basement remodel contractors you’re considering are licensed and insured. This protects you from potential liability in case of accidents or damage during the project. It also demonstrates the contractor’s commitment to professionalism.
Obtain Multiple Quotes:
Don’t rush into hiring the first contractor you find. Reach out to at least three different basement remodel contractors in Orland Park, IL, to obtain quotes. This will enable you to assess and compare their pricing, services, and project timelines, helping you make an informed decision.
Check References:
Request references from potential contractors. Speaking with previous clients can give you insight into the quality of their work, communication skills, and overall satisfaction with the contractor.
Detailed Contract:
Once you’ve chosen a contractor, ensure that your contract is detailed and covers all aspects of the project, including the scope of work, materials, timelines, and payment schedule. This document will serve as a crucial reference point throughout the project.
Set a Realistic Budget:
Determine a realistic budget for your basement remodeling project and communicate it clearly to the contractor. Be prepared for unexpected expenses, and have a contingency fund in case of unforeseen issues.
Regular Communication:
Maintain open and clear communication with your chosen basement remodel contractor. Discuss any concerns or changes as they arise, and encourage the contractor to do the same.
Progress Inspections:
Regularly inspect the work being done in your basement. This helps ensure that the project is progressing as planned and that any issues are addressed promptly.
Payment Schedule
Follow the agreed-upon payment schedule outlined in your contract. Avoid making large upfront payments. Instead, tie payments to specific project milestones or phases.
Respect Their Expertise
Remember that basement remodel contractors are experts in their field. While your input is valuable, trust their professional judgment when it comes to design and construction decisions.
Don’ts
Don’t Rush the Hiring Process
Take your time when selecting basement remodel contractors. Rushing this decision can lead to mistakes that may be costly to rectify later.
Don’t Skip the Written Contract
Never start a basement remodeling project without a written contract. Verbal agreements are hard to enforce and can lead to misunderstandings.
Don’t Ignore Permits
Ensure that all necessary permits are obtained for your basement remodel project in Orland Park, IL. Failure to do so can result in legal and safety issues down the road.
Don’t Make Hasty Changes
While changes may be necessary, avoid making too many last-minute alterations to the project. This can disrupt the workflow and increase costs.
Don’t Pay in Cash
Avoid making cash payments to basement remodeling contractors. Stick to a secure payment method, such as checks or credit cards, to maintain a clear payment trail.
Don’t Neglect Insurance
Confirm that the contractor has liability insurance and that their workers are covered by worker’s compensation insurance. This safeguards you from potential legal issues if accidents occur on your property.
Don’t Micromanage
While it’s essential to stay informed and involved, avoid micromanaging the contractor. Trust their expertise and allow them to do their job.
Don’t Forget About Clean-up
Discuss the clean-up process with your contractor. Ensure that they leave your basement in a clean and safe condition once the project is complete.
Don’t Withhold Payments Unfairly
Withholding payments should be done according to the terms of your contract and only for valid reasons, such as incomplete work or unsatisfactory results.
Don’t Ignore Your Gut Feeling
If something doesn’t feel right with a contractor, trust your instincts. It’s essential to work with someone you feel comfortable with and can trust throughout the project.
